WaitForPort - Waits 10 secs for port to appear
PORTNAME/A, I=INTERVAL/K/N, L=LOOP/K/N, D=DISAPPEAR/S
PORTNAME - Name of the port to wait for INTERVAL - Only checks for the port every INTERVAL seconds (Default=1) LOOP - Number of time to loop (Default=10) DISAPPEAR - Check for the port to disappear instead of appear
WaitForPort waits (10 seconds by default) for the specified port to appear. A return code of 0 indicates that the port was found. A return code of 5 indicates that the application is not currently running or that the port does not exist.
Example:
MorphOS:> WaitForPort INTERVAL=1 LOOP=5 MIAMI.1
- => Waits 1 second and check for the presence of the 'MIAMI.1' port. Do that 5 times.
 
NOTE: Port names are case sensitive.
